28 connections·40 entities in this video→Discovery of the Khara-Hora Shaft
- 💡 In 2011, Russian speleologist Arthur Zimikov discovered a deep shaft in the Khara-Hora mountain range, featuring remarkably smooth, straight walls.
- 🚀 Zimikov and his team descended the shaft, finding it to be hundreds of meters deep and composed of evenly sized stones, suggesting it was man-made.
- 🗺️ The location is in the rugged Caucasus Mountains, a region known for its geological features and historical significance.
Theories and Investigations
- 🕵️♂️ Various theories surround the shaft's origin, including construction by an advanced ancient civilization, a secret World War II superweapon, or a natural geological formation.
- 🗣️ Zimikov's friend, Victor Kultys, claimed the shaft led to an underground city with tunnels extending up to 72 km.
- 🌐 The group Cosmopoisk, led by Vadim Chernabrov, also investigated the site, though they did not publish their findings.
- 📸 Alexander Splashnov, a cave enthusiast, documented the shaft with 3D renders, leading some to mistakenly believe the entire discovery was fabricated.
Historical and Occult Connections
- 卐 Nazi forces were present in the Caucasus in 1942, and a swastika symbol on Khara-Hora has led to speculation they may have been searching for or involved with the shaft, possibly linked to occult beliefs about an ancient Aryan civilization.
- ☭ A Reddit theory suggests the Soviets later carved the swastika as a false flag to mislead investigations into a potential secret government experiment or weapon testing site.
- 🌍 The concept of a "solar induced dark age" suggests a network of underground cities, with Khara-Hora proposed as one such location.
- 🚀 A more extreme theory posits the shaft is connected to a planetary weapon, possibly inspired by Joseph P. Farrell's ideas about the Giza pyramid.
Mysterious Deaths and Natural Explanations
- 💔 The deaths of Arthur Zimikov (hit by a car) and Vadim Chernabrov (cancer) shortly after their involvement with the shaft have fueled rumors of a curse or silencing.
- ⛰️ The most accepted explanation is that the Khara-Hora shaft is a natural formation, a result of volcanic rock cracking along fault lines and undergoing chemical weathering, similar to processes seen at Devil's Tower.
- 🧱 The formation's appearance of being man-made is attributed to columner jointing and erosion, which can create regular patterns in rock.
- 🏡 A similar natural phenomenon is observed in Rockwall, Texas, where a "rock wall" turned out to be a natural geological feature.
Conclusion and Documentary
- ✨ While the Khara-Hora shaft has inspired numerous theories, the most parsimonious explanation is that it is a remarkable natural cave.
